DTC DETECTION LOGIC
| DTC No. | Trouble diagnosis name | DTC detecting condition | Possible cause | |
| P2119 | Electric throttle control actuator | A | Electric throttle control actuator does not function properly due to the return spring malfunction. | Electric throttle control actuator |
| B | Throttle valve opening angle in fail-safe mode is Electric throttle control actuator not in specified range. | |||
| C | ECM detect the throttle valve is stuck open. | |||
